These are two 1950 magazine advertisements for Wente Bros. Wines produced and bottled at the winery by Wente Bros., Livermore, CA.
One ad is for Dry Semillion, a Sauterne, and the other is for Pinot Blanc, a white burgundy. --- Founded in 1883, Wente Vineyards is the oldest continuously-operated, family-owned winery in the country; owned and managed by the fourth and fifth generations of the Wente family. The winery draws from nearly 3,000 acres of Estate vineyards in the Livermore Valley, San Francisco Bay and Arroyo Seco, Monterey appellations to create an outstanding portfolio of fine wines. Wente Vineyards is distributed in all 50 states and in over 70 countries worldwide.
